Microdata of India in IPUMS: NSSO Schedule 10 samples Microdata of India in IPUMS: NSSO Schedule 10 samples

under MOU with MOSPIunder MOU with MOSPI In 1999, the RG of India was invited to be a founding In 1999, the RG of India was invited to be a founding

member of IPUMS-Internationalmember of IPUMS-International To date, with 90 official statistical offices participating…The To date, with 90 official statistical offices participating…The

Government of India has not yet decided to participate--Government of India has not yet decided to participate--discussions continuediscussions continue

A lesson in Indian democracy from the prime minister’s A lesson in Indian democracy from the prime minister’s office (Sept. 2005): organize academic supportoffice (Sept. 2005): organize academic support

With your support, success—samples for 1991, 2001 and With your support, success—samples for 1991, 2001 and ultimately 2011—may be possible ultimately 2011—may be possible

What are microdata? What are microdata? They are the individual They are the individual responses to a survey, responses to a survey, such as: NSS Sch. 10 such as: NSS Sch. 10

(1983).(1983).Each line on the form Each line on the form is one unit (microdata) is one unit (microdata)

record. record.

Samples are integrated: identical concepts have the same Samples are integrated: identical concepts have the same

codes in all samplescodes in all samples   Universal population coverage and large sample sizes Universal population coverage and large sample sizes Robust analysis of Robust analysis of

Fertility and mortality levels: own-child methods, Fertility and mortality levels: own-child methods, reports on births and deaths in the household in the past reports on births and deaths in the household in the past 12 months.  12 months. 

Disability and access to health care.  Disability and access to health care.  Household sanitation variables (water supply, toilet, and Household sanitation variables (water supply, toilet, and

sewage facilities) to track progress toward Millennium sewage facilities) to track progress toward Millennium Development Goals. Development Goals.

» In 1999, our dream: integrate samples of 21 countries in 10 In 1999, our dream: integrate samples of 21 countries in 10 yearsyears

» Thanks to generous cooperation of 55 National Statistical OfficesThanks to generous cooperation of 55 National Statistical Offices» Undreamed technological innovationsUndreamed technological innovations

» By 2010, integrated samples for 55 countriesBy 2010, integrated samples for 55 countries» 159 samples, 325 million person records159 samples, 325 million person records» Number of users and usage far exceeded expectationsNumber of users and usage far exceeded expectations

» For the 2010 decade, our dream: For the 2010 decade, our dream: » Double (2x) the number of integrated samples to 300Double (2x) the number of integrated samples to 300» Triple (3x) the number of users to 12,000Triple (3x) the number of users to 12,000» Quadruple (4x) research output Quadruple (4x) research output
